The Challenge

When replacing a water heater, it’s rarely just about swapping one tank for another. Modern plumbing codes and municipal water systems often require additional safety measures that older installations lack.

  • Thermal Expansion: As water heats, it expands. Because many modern homes operate on “closed” plumbing systems (due to backflow preventers at the city meter), this expanding water has nowhere to go, putting immense pressure on the water heater tank and the home’s pipes.

  • Seismic Safety: Being in California, the unit must be heavily secured against earthquake activity to prevent the tank from tipping, which could cause massive water damage or a dangerous gas leak.

  • Venting and Connections: The existing gas lines, water connectors, and exhaust venting needed to be evaluated and replaced to ensure leak-free, safe operation.

The Solution

The experts at Pat’s Plumbing and Drains designed a comprehensive, code-compliant installation to give the homeowner peace of mind.

Here is what our licensed technicians did:

  1. Premium Tank Installation: We installed a new Rheem® Performance™ Gas Water Heater. Rheem is a trusted, industry-leading brand known for its durability and consistent hot water delivery.

  2. Thermal Expansion Tank Integration: To solve the closed-system pressure issue, we installed a thermal expansion tank (the white tank visible above the main unit) on the cold-water inlet line. This tank acts as a shock absorber, taking in the excess volume of expanding hot water and protecting the glass lining of the new water heater from pressure-induced stress.

  3. Code-Compliant Seismic Strapping: We heavily secured the new water heater using heavy-duty, state-approved seismic straps positioned at the top and bottom-third of the tank to ensure it remains safely in place during any seismic event.

  4. Upgraded Connections & Safety Valves: * Installed new color-coded (red for hot, blue for cold) corrugated flex water lines.

    • Installed a new, safe yellow corrugated gas line with a secure shut-off valve.

    • Routed the Temperature and Pressure (T&P) relief valve safely downward using a rigid white PVC discharge pipe, topped with protective foam insulation to prevent weather degradation.

    • Re-secured and sealed the galvanized exhaust vent with foil tape to ensure carbon monoxide is safely drafted up and out of the enclosure.

The Results

The San Diego homeowner now has a highly efficient, safe, and fully code-compliant hot water system. By taking the extra steps to install the thermal expansion tank and secure the unit with heavy-duty seismic strapping, Pat’s Plumbing and Drains ensured that this Rheem water heater will operate safely and efficiently for years to come, without putting undue stress on the home’s plumbing infrastructure.
